A uniform electric field has magnitude E and is directed in the negative x-direction. The potential difference between point a (at x = 0.60 m) and %3D point b (at x = 0.90 m) is 240 V. A negative point charge q = -0.200 mC moves from a to b. Calculate the work done on the point charge by the electric field.
